Donald Trump's state visit to the UK set for 3 June

US President Donald Trump will make a three-day state visit to the UK from 3 to 5 June, Buckingham Palace has announced.
The president and First Lady Melania Trump will be a guest of the Queen and attend a ceremony in Portsmouth to mark the 75th Anniversary of D-Day
He will also hold talks with the prime minister at Downing Street.
Mr Trump met the Queen at Windsor Castle when he came to the UK in July 2018 on a working visit.
He also held talks with Mrs May at Chequers before heading to Scotland, where he owns the Turnberry golf course.
The president was promised the visit by Prime Minister Theresa May after he was elected in 2016 - but no date was set.
Mrs May said the State Visit was an "opportunity to strengthen our already close relationship".
